summaryrefslogtreecommitdiff
path: root/Makefile.in
diff options
context:
space:
mode:
authorsascha <sascha@13f79535-47bb-0310-9956-ffa450edef68>2000-12-15 16:56:57 +0000
committersascha <sascha@13f79535-47bb-0310-9956-ffa450edef68>2000-12-15 16:56:57 +0000
commit0eee6ce8ea2d1a76b49f53dd0671e04f386fde6e (patch)
tree7fc8d573a0807c5051f75d65872b427cb7e8ad7e /Makefile.in
parentcc72cfda39b68d39a4644ec8f4aa9c66e2be12ad (diff)
downloadlibapr-0eee6ce8ea2d1a76b49f53dd0671e04f386fde6e.tar.gz
Fix VPATH support. APR builds now cleanly in a separate build directory.
Submitted by: Mo DeJong <mdejong@cygnus.com> git-svn-id: http://svn.apache.org/repos/asf/apr/apr/trunk@60956 13f79535-47bb-0310-9956-ffa450edef68
Diffstat (limited to 'Makefile.in')
-rw-r--r--Makefile.in12
1 files changed, 10 insertions, 2 deletions
diff --git a/Makefile.in b/Makefile.in
index c9b83118e..85a0ddd4d 100644
--- a/Makefile.in
+++ b/Makefile.in
@@ -116,10 +116,18 @@ delete-exports:
fi
$(TARGET_EXPORTS):
- perl ./helpers/make_export.pl -o $@ include/*.h
+ if test -z "$(srcdir)"; then \
+ perl $(srcdir)helpers/make_export.pl -o $@ include/*.h; \
+ else \
+ perl $(srcdir)helpers/make_export.pl -o $@ include/*.h $(srcdir)include/*.h; \
+ fi
docs:
- ./helpers/scandoc -i./helpers/default.pl -p./docs/ ./include/*.h
+ if test -z "$(srcdir)"; then \
+ $(srcdir)helpers/scandoc -i$(srcdir)helpers/default.pl -p./docs/ ./include/*.h; \
+ else \
+ $(srcdir)helpers/scandoc -i$(srcdir)helpers/default.pl -p./docs/ ./include/*.h $(srcdir)include/*.h; \
+ fi
test: $(LIBAPR)
(cd test; make clean; make; \